  • Abstract
    Team building and project planning workshops have been successfully used to initiate the focus of interdisciplinary student teams. The team centered workshop consists of a variety and range of activities to accommodate various learning styles. Training in project planning helps a group identify and sequence project tasks, thus enabling team members to understand the relationships between their efforts and those of the other members of the team. Furthermore, the project planning workshop culminates in a preliminary plan for a project
